import { ENGINE_SIZE_FILTER_ID } from 'lib/constants'; import { getProductFilters } from 'lib/shopify'; import { getCollectionUrl } from 'lib/utils'; import Link from 'next/link'; const EngineSizes = async ({ collectionHandle }: { collectionHandle: string }) => { // eg: collectionHandle = transmission_bmw_x5 const makeFromCollectionHandle = collectionHandle.split('_')[1]; if (!makeFromCollectionHandle) { return null; } const engineSizes = await getProductFilters( { collection: collectionHandle }, ENGINE_SIZE_FILTER_ID ); if (!engineSizes || engineSizes.values.length === 0) { return null; } return (